Advanced Anti-Extension/Rotation Exercise – Reverse Valslide Hand Walking

Right now this is one of my favorite advanced core progressions for my general population clients who have progressed beyond bodysaws, shoulder taps and stir the pot. I like that it produces a similar core stress as some of the previously mentioned exercises but with the added benefit of shoulder work from crawling.

My friend Matt makes them look easy but don’t be fooled this variation is pretty tough. Be sure to go extra slow and keep the hips as still as possible. If you struggle to keep your hips still widen the feet and focus on contracting the glutes. You should look to maintain a straight line between your head, thoracic spine and sacrum throughout the exercise.
